Technical Challenges Behind Rapid Payouts
Instant payout systems are not just a matter of flipping a switch. Behind the scenes, online casinos must navigate complex regulatory frameworks, identity verification procedures, and fraud prevention measures. These steps are crucial to protect both the player and the platform, but they can slow down the process.
Blockchain and secure APIs have been instrumental in mitigating these issues. For example, some blockchain-powered casinos now offer near-instant settlements without compromising compliance, making the concept of online casino instant withdrawal more than just a convenience—it’s a competitive necessity.

Tips for Navigating Instant Withdrawal Features
While instant withdrawals are appealing, players should still approach them with a bit of caution. Here are some practical things to keep in mind:
- Check the withdrawal limits and whether instant payouts apply to your chosen payment method.
- Ensure your account verification is fully complete before expecting fast transfers.
- Be aware of any wagering requirements or bonus conditions that might delay withdrawals.
- Compare how different casinos handle withdrawal times—sometimes advertised instant payouts can still take hours.
- Keep track of transaction fees; some payment methods may charge for rapid transfers.

Responsible Gaming and Financial Awareness
Instant access to winnings can be enticing, but it also raises questions about responsible gambling. Having funds available immediately might tempt players to chase losses or make impulsive decisions. It’s important to maintain balance and set personal limits regardless of how fast money moves.
Many reputable operators incorporate tools to help manage spending and provide education about gambling risks. Recognizing that fast withdrawals are just one piece of a healthy gaming environment is key to long-term enjoyment.
